WARNING: The appliance and its

accessible parts become hot during

use. Care should be taken to avoid

touching heating elements. Children

less than 8 years of age shall be kept

away unless continuously supervised.
WARNING: Unattended cooking on a

hob with fat or oil can be dangerous

and may result in fire. NEVER try to

extinguish a fire with water, but switch

off the appliance and then cover

flame e.g. with a lid or a fire blanket.
WARNING: Danger of fire : do not

store items on the cooking surfaces.
WARNING: If the top plate is cracked,

do not touch it and turn off the main

power switch to avoid the possibility

of electric shock. Contact the dealer

where you purchased the appliance

for repair.

CAUTION:

Failure to follow these instructions may cause

injury or property damage.

-If the oil emits smoke, immediately

turn off the main power switch.

Otherwise, it may catch fire.

-Pay attention to spattering hot oil.

Do not let your face get near the

cookware. This may cause burns.

-Do not use oil preheated by other

appliances, such as a gas range.

Otherwise, the “

oil temperature

control system” will not work properly

and may cause fire.

-Pay extra attention when preheating

the pan with a small amount of

oil. The pan may overheat and get

damaged.

-Keep cookware stable. Otherwise, it

may cause injuries or burns.
